Standard Aquarium Sizes Reference Table
Producers produce standard-sized glass aquariums with pre-calculated dimensions and volumes. However, it is essential to note the distinction in between nominal volume (what the manufacturer calls the tank) and actual volume (accounting for substrate, driftwood, and the space left at the top).

Accounting for Displacement: The Hidden Factor
One typical mistake aquarists make is assuming a 50-gallon tank holds 50 gallons of water. In reality, physical objects inside the tank displace water. Stopping working to represent displacement can lead to accidental over-dosing of medications or fertilizers.

Frequently Asked Questions About Aquarium Volume1. Do glass thickness and framing impact the estimation?
Yes, slightly. When using an aquarium gallon calculator, measurements ought to ideally be taken from the within the tank. Exterior measurements include the plastic rim and glass density, which can make the tank calculator fish appear to hold a little more water than it actually does.
2. How much does a filled aquarium weigh?
Water is incredibly heavy. One United States gallon of fresh water weighs around 8.34 pounds (saltwater is somewhat much heavier at roughly 8.55 pounds per gallon).
3. Are US gallons and Imperial gallons the exact same?
No. An US gallon equates to 231 cubic inches, whereas an Imperial gallon (utilized in the UK and some Commonwealth nations) equals around 277.4 cubic inches. Online aquarium calculators typically default to United States gallons, so international enthusiasts should double-check their calculator's system settings.
